Alignerr is seeking a Lean 4 Proof Engineer to translate advanced mathematical reasoning into machine-verifiable Lean 4 code.

This role sits at the frontier of formal verification and AI, demanding precision, structure, and an instinct for rigorous argumentation.

You'll work remotely on an hourly contract, with 10–40 hours per week, collaborating with AI researchers to push the limits of proof assistants and develop reusable, readable formalizations.
